typedef struct JSTrap {
JSCList links;
JSScript *script;
jsbytecode *pc;
JSOp op;
JSTrapHandler handler;
jsval closure;
} JSTrap;
2023-07-12 13:27:26 +10:00
#define DBG_LOCK(rt) JS_ACQUIRE_LOCK((rt)->debuggerLock)
#define DBG_UNLOCK(rt) JS_RELEASE_LOCK((rt)->debuggerLock)
#define DBG_LOCK_EVAL(rt,expr) (DBG_LOCK(rt), (expr), DBG_UNLOCK(rt))
JS_PUBLIC_API(JSBool)
JS_GetDebugMode(JSContext *cx)
{
return cx->compartment->debugMode;
}
JS_PUBLIC_API(JSBool)
JS_SetDebugMode(JSContext *cx, JSBool debug)
{
return JS_SetDebugModeForCompartment(cx, cx->compartment, debug);
}
JS_PUBLIC_API(void)
JS_SetRuntimeDebugMode(JSRuntime *rt, JSBool debug)
{
rt->debugMode = debug;
}
#ifdef DEBUG
static bool
CompartmentHasLiveScripts(JSCompartment *comp)
{
#ifdef JS_METHODJIT
# ifdef JS_THREADSAFE
jsword currentThreadId = reinterpret_cast<jsword>(js_CurrentThreadId());
# endif
#endif
// Unsynchronized context iteration is technically a race; but this is only
// for debug asserts where such a race would be rare
JSContext *iter = NULL;
JSContext *icx;
while ((icx = JS_ContextIterator(comp->rt, &iter))) {
#ifdef JS_THREADSAFE
if (JS_GetContextThread(icx) != currentThreadId)
continue;
#endif
for (AllFramesIter i(icx); !i.done(); ++i) {
JSScript *script = i.fp()->maybeScript();
if (script && script->compartment == comp)
return JS_TRUE;
}
}
return JS_FALSE;
}
#endif
JS_FRIEND_API(JSBool)
JS_SetDebugModeForCompartment(JSContext *cx, JSCompartment *comp, JSBool debug)
{
if (comp->debugMode == !!debug)
return JS_TRUE;
// This should only be called when no scripts are live. It would even be
// incorrect to discard just the non-live scripts' JITScripts because they
// might share ICs with live scripts (bug 632343).
JS_ASSERT(!CompartmentHasLiveScripts(comp));
// All scripts compiled from this point on should be in the requested debugMode.
comp->debugMode = !!debug;
// Discard JIT code for any scripts that change debugMode. This function
// assumes that 'comp' is in the same thread as 'cx'.
#ifdef JS_METHODJIT
JSAutoEnterCompartment ac;
for (JSScript *script = (JSScript *)comp->scripts.next;
&script->links != &comp->scripts;
script = (JSScript *)script->links.next)
{
if (!script->debugMode == !debug)
continue;
/*
* If compartment entry fails, debug mode is left partially on, leading
* to a small performance overhead but no loss of correctness. We set
* the debug flags to false so that the caller will not later attempt
* to use debugging features.
*/
if (!ac.entered() && !ac.enter(cx, script)) {
comp->debugMode = JS_FALSE;
return JS_FALSE;
}
mjit::ReleaseScriptCode(cx, script);
script->debugMode = !!debug;
}
#endif
return JS_TRUE;
}
JS_FRIEND_API(JSBool)
js_SetSingleStepMode(JSContext *cx, JSScript *script, JSBool singleStep)
{
#ifdef JS_METHODJIT
if (!script->singleStepMode == !singleStep)
return JS_TRUE;
#endif
JS_ASSERT_IF(singleStep, cx->compartment->debugMode);
#ifdef JS_METHODJIT
/* request the next recompile to inject single step interrupts */
script->singleStepMode = !!singleStep;
js::mjit::JITScript *jit = script->jitNormal ? script->jitNormal : script->jitCtor;
if (jit && script->singleStepMode != jit->singleStepMode) {
js::mjit::Recompiler recompiler(cx, script);
if (!recompiler.recompile()) {
script->singleStepMode = !singleStep;
return JS_FALSE;
}
}
#endif
return JS_TRUE;
}
static JSBool
CheckDebugMode(JSContext *cx)
{
JSBool debugMode = JS_GetDebugMode(cx);
/*
* :TODO:
* This probably should be an assertion, since it's indicative of a severe
* API misuse.
*/
if (!debugMode) {
JS_ReportErrorFlagsAndNumber(cx, JSREPORT_ERROR, js_GetErrorMessage,
NULL, JSMSG_NEED_DEBUG_MODE);
}
return debugMode;
}
JS_PUBLIC_API(JSBool)
JS_SetSingleStepMode(JSContext *cx, JSScript *script, JSBool singleStep)
{
if (!CheckDebugMode(cx))
return JS_FALSE;
return js_SetSingleStepMode(cx, script, singleStep);
}

/************************************************************************/
JS_PUBLIC_API(uintN)
JS_PCToLineNumber(JSContext *cx, JSScript *script, jsbytecode *pc)
{
return js_PCToLineNumber(cx, script, pc);
}
JS_PUBLIC_API(jsbytecode *)
JS_LineNumberToPC(JSContext *cx, JSScript *script, uintN lineno)
{
return js_LineNumberToPC(script, lineno);
}
JS_PUBLIC_API(jsbytecode *)
JS_EndPC(JSContext *cx, JSScript *script)
{
return script->code + script->length;
}
JS_PUBLIC_API(uintN)
JS_GetFunctionArgumentCount(JSContext *cx, JSFunction *fun)
{
return fun->nargs;
}
JS_PUBLIC_API(JSBool)
JS_FunctionHasLocalNames(JSContext *cx, JSFunction *fun)
{
return fun->script()->bindings.hasLocalNames();
}
extern JS_PUBLIC_API(jsuword *)
JS_GetFunctionLocalNameArray(JSContext *cx, JSFunction *fun, void **markp)
{
*markp = JS_ARENA_MARK(&cx->tempPool);
return fun->script()->bindings.getLocalNameArray(cx, &cx->tempPool);
}
extern JS_PUBLIC_API(JSAtom *)
JS_LocalNameToAtom(jsuword w)
{
return JS_LOCAL_NAME_TO_ATOM(w);
}
extern JS_PUBLIC_API(JSString *)
JS_AtomKey(JSAtom *atom)
{
return ATOM_TO_STRING(atom);
}
extern JS_PUBLIC_API(void)
JS_ReleaseFunctionLocalNameArray(JSContext *cx, void *mark)
{
JS_ARENA_RELEASE(&cx->tempPool, mark);
}
JS_PUBLIC_API(JSScript *)
JS_GetFunctionScript(JSContext *cx, JSFunction *fun)
{
return FUN_SCRIPT(fun);
}
JS_PUBLIC_API(JSNative)
JS_GetFunctionNative(JSContext *cx, JSFunction *fun)
{
return Jsvalify(fun->maybeNative());
2023-07-12 13:27:26 +10:00
}
JS_PUBLIC_API(JSPrincipals *)
JS_GetScriptPrincipals(JSContext *cx, JSScript *script)
{
return script->principals;
}

#ifdef MOZ_CALLGRIND
#include <valgrind/callgrind.h>
JS_FRIEND_API(JSBool)
js_StartCallgrind(JSContext *cx, uintN argc, jsval *vp)
{
CALLGRIND_START_INSTRUMENTATION;
CALLGRIND_ZERO_STATS;
JS_SET_RVAL(cx, vp, JSVAL_VOID);
return JS_TRUE;
}
JS_FRIEND_API(JSBool)
js_StopCallgrind(JSContext *cx, uintN argc, jsval *vp)
{
CALLGRIND_STOP_INSTRUMENTATION;
JS_SET_RVAL(cx, vp, JSVAL_VOID);
return JS_TRUE;
}
JS_FRIEND_API(JSBool)
js_DumpCallgrind(JSContext *cx, uintN argc, jsval *vp)
{
JSString *str;
jsval *argv = JS_ARGV(cx, vp);
if (argc > 0 && JSVAL_IS_STRING(argv[0])) {
str = JSVAL_TO_STRING(argv[0]);
JSAutoByteString bytes(cx, str);
if (!!bytes) {
CALLGRIND_DUMP_STATS_AT(bytes.ptr());
return JS_TRUE;
}
}
CALLGRIND_DUMP_STATS;
JS_SET_RVAL(cx, vp, JSVAL_VOID);
return JS_TRUE;
}
#endif /* MOZ_CALLGRIND */
#ifdef MOZ_VTUNE
#include <VTuneApi.h>
static const char *vtuneErrorMessages[] = {
"unknown, error #0",
"invalid 'max samples' field",
"invalid 'samples per buffer' field",
"invalid 'sample interval' field",
"invalid path",
"sample file in use",
"invalid 'number of events' field",
"unknown, error #7",
"internal error",
"bad event name",
"VTStopSampling called without calling VTStartSampling",
"no events selected for event-based sampling",
"events selected cannot be run together",
"no sampling parameters",
"sample database already exists",
"sampling already started",
"time-based sampling not supported",
"invalid 'sampling parameters size' field",
"invalid 'event size' field",
"sampling file already bound",
"invalid event path",
"invalid license",
"invalid 'global options' field",
};
JS_FRIEND_API(JSBool)
js_StartVtune(JSContext *cx, uintN argc, jsval *vp)
{
VTUNE_EVENT events[] = {
{ 1000000, 0, 0, 0, "CPU_CLK_UNHALTED.CORE" },
{ 1000000, 0, 0, 0, "INST_RETIRED.ANY" },
};
U32 n_events = sizeof(events) / sizeof(VTUNE_EVENT);
char *default_filename = "mozilla-vtune.tb5";
JSString *str;
U32 status;
VTUNE_SAMPLING_PARAMS params = {
sizeof(VTUNE_SAMPLING_PARAMS),
sizeof(VTUNE_EVENT),
0, 0, /* Reserved fields */
1, /* Initialize in "paused" state */
0, /* Max samples, or 0 for "continuous" */
4096, /* Samples per buffer */
0.1, /* Sampling interval in ms */
1, /* 1 for event-based sampling, 0 for time-based */
n_events,
events,
default_filename,
};
jsval *argv = JS_ARGV(cx, vp);
if (argc > 0 && JSVAL_IS_STRING(argv[0])) {
str = JSVAL_TO_STRING(argv[0]);
params.tb5Filename = js_DeflateString(cx, str->chars(), str->length());
}
status = VTStartSampling(&params);
if (params.tb5Filename != default_filename)
cx->free(params.tb5Filename);
if (status != 0) {
if (status == VTAPI_MULTIPLE_RUNS)
VTStopSampling(0);
if (status < sizeof(vtuneErrorMessages))
JS_ReportError(cx, "Vtune setup error: %s",
vtuneErrorMessages[status]);
else
JS_ReportError(cx, "Vtune setup error: %d",
status);
return false;
}
JS_SET_RVAL(cx, vp, JSVAL_VOID);
return true;
}
JS_FRIEND_API(JSBool)
js_StopVtune(JSContext *cx, uintN argc, jsval *vp)
{
U32 status = VTStopSampling(1);
if (status) {
if (status < sizeof(vtuneErrorMessages))
JS_ReportError(cx, "Vtune shutdown error: %s",
vtuneErrorMessages[status]);
else
JS_ReportError(cx, "Vtune shutdown error: %d",
status);
return false;
}
JS_SET_RVAL(cx, vp, JSVAL_VOID);
return true;
}
JS_FRIEND_API(JSBool)
js_PauseVtune(JSContext *cx, uintN argc, jsval *vp)
{
VTPause();
JS_SET_RVAL(cx, vp, JSVAL_VOID);
return true;
}
JS_FRIEND_API(JSBool)
js_ResumeVtune(JSContext *cx, uintN argc, jsval *vp)
{
VTResume();
JS_SET_RVAL(cx, vp, JSVAL_VOID);
return true;
}
#endif /* MOZ_VTUNE */
